WMIProviderHost.exe process is a Trojan Coin Miner that uses the contaminated computer’s resources to mine electronic currency without your authorization. It can be Monero, Bitcoin, DarkCoin or Ethereum.

About “wmiproviderhost.exe”

wmiproviderhost.exe process will use greater than 70% of your CPU’s power and graphics cards sources

What this indicates, is that when the miners are running you will certainly locate that your computer is running slower as well as video games are faltering or cold since the wmiproviderhost.exe is using your computer system’s resources to generate income for themselves. This will cause your CPU to run at really hot temperatures for prolonged amount of times, which could reduce the life of the CPU.

wmiproviderhost.exe Technical Summary.

File Name wmiproviderhost.exe
Type Trojan Coin Miner
Detection Name Trojan:Win32/CoinMiner
Distribution Method Software bundling, Intrusive advertisement, redirects to shady sites etc.
Similar behavior Wudfhosts, Wlanext, System64

Reducing down your PC, running at peek level for lengthy times may trigger damage to your device and raise power expenses.

When a PC is infected with wmiproviderhost.exe trojan, typical signs consist of:

  • Very high CPU as well as graphics cards use
  • Windows reduce and also make the most of gradually, as well as programs run slower.
  • Programs don’t release as rapidly.
  • General slowness when making use of the computer.

How to detect wmiproviderhost.exe Coin Miner Trojan?

Unlike ransomware, cryptocurrencies mining hazards are not meddlesome and also are more probable to stay undetected by the victim.

Nonetheless, discovering wmiproviderhost.exe threat is fairly very easy. If the target is using a GridinSoft Anti-Malware it is almost particular to find any kind of mining malware. Even without a safety and security service, the sufferer is most likely to think there is something incorrect since mining b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ies is a really source extensive procedure. The most common sign is an obvious and also usually consistent drop in performance.

This symptom alone does not tell the victim what the precise issue is. The customer can experience comparable issues for a range of factors. Still, wmiproviderhost.exe malware can be extremely turbulent since it will certainly hog all offered computing power and the sudden change in the means the contaminated gadget performs is likely to make the target search for solutions. If the hardware of the impacted device is powerful sufficient, and the target does not identify and remove the danger promptly, the power usage and subsequently the electrical power costs will certainly go up significantly as well.
